Arrival Dismissal Procedures

Arrival Procedures

  • Students should not arrive before 7:30 am unless they are eating breakfast in the cafeteria.
  • Students eating breakfast should go to the cafeteria at 7:40 am.
  • Children arriving between 7:40 and 8:00 will wait in assigned area by class
  • Students will be permitted to enter the classrooms at 8:05 to prepare for instruction to begin at 8:15 am.
  • Children arriving after 8:15 am are tardy and must report to the office for a pass.

Drop Off/Pick-Up Procedures

  • Use the Kiss and Ride line for Morning Drop Off/Afternoon Pick-up
  • This is a drop off/pick-up only zone. Do not exit your vehicle in this zone.
  • Drive forward all the way to the end of loading/unloading zone or to the car parked in front of you.
  • Make sure your children have their things prepared in advance for unloading. This will help us to speed up the process.
  • As soon as you are stopped and are between LOADING/UNLOADING ZONE signs, quickly load/unload students.
  • Do not use the front parking lot for dropping off students. This is not zoned for unloading students.

Walk In

Park in the parking lot if you want to walk your child into the school. Do not leave children less than 12 years of age unattended in your vehicle.

Rainy Day Dismissal

We will use the rainy day dismissal plan on days when it is pouring, and/or there is thunder and lightning. If there is lightning, no students will be allowed to walk or ride their bike home. The decision will be made at 2:45p.m. based on the weather conditions at Kessler Elementary at that time. 
Our procedure will be as follows:

  • All car riders will dismiss to the gym as normal. All bus riders will dismiss as normal. Please do not exit your car and come into the building to pick up your child. We will try to expedite the departure of our students and need to ensure each child's safety. Please make sure your car rider sign is clearly displayed, so we may call your child(ren) as quickly as possible.
